HC Deb 23 April 1958 vol 586 cc76-7W
66. Captain Kerby

asked the Secretary of State for Air what representations have been made to his Department about paragraphs 50, 51, 52 and 87 of Air Publication No. 826, Regulations for Civilian Employees at Air Ministry Establishments, alleging that some or all of these paragraphs reserve to his Department the right to make deductions from employees' wages, and asking for these paragraphs to be amended so that no right is reserved to the Air Ministry the exercise of which would be a breach of the Truck Acts; and what action he has taken.

Mr. C. I. Orr-Ewing

Representations have been made by the Aeronautical Engineers' Association. My right hon. Friend sees no reason to make any change.
